What will you do?

Our Business System Analyst will use both business and Salesforce platform skills to evaluate a company’s operating systems and procedures and design improvements. They typically consult with Business Users, Product Manager, Product Owner or other leaders of functional areas to understand how they use Salesforce systems, research emerging features in Salesforce that might be a good fit for the company, analyze costs and benefits, perform POC, implement new features and train the business users, or write instruction manuals. Additionally, the Business System Analyst work with Software Developer Engineer and Solution Architects to ensure that the application meets company service level standards and roadmap requirements

Your primary responsibilities will include:

ANALYST responsibilities

  • Analyzing a broadly defined area and using functional decomposition to define high-level epics and stories to create a well-organized Product Backlog
  • Analyze and translate business requirements and acceptance criteria into functional and non-function system requirements
  • Experience with common business Sales or Support processes, such as Marketing, Sales, and Services development - Lead and Opportunity capture, or Case Management processes.
  • Design reliable/scalable/reusable/future-proof technical solutions to the business requirements/specifications/acceptance criteria and can effectively present your technical solutions to the review board in the format of POC or flow diagrams.
  • Identifying related user stories and epics, grouping them into themes as necessary, and documenting the interrelationship and associated business process flows, as necessary. The interrelationship of user stories and epics should be well-understood and the implementation of stories across different functional areas may require some planning and coordination so that they are consistently implemented
  • Contribute to the scrum team by involving in Grooming/Planning/Retrospective/Scrum meetings, especially helping Product Owners in story writing, and grooming so that developers can provide consistent and reliable LOE estimates.
  • Work with the enterprise architects and the solution architects to design a technical solution that meets the company’s service level standard, security requirement and minimizes the dependency of the upstream teams and the impact to the downstream teams
  • Work with the product owner to understand the acceptance criteria and provide alternatives to any unattainable asks.
  • Understand the business complexity and provide resolution/workaround to the user's problems.
  • Describe issues and work with the development team on engineering and implementation of technical solutions to them.
  • Provide onboarding assistance to new team members
  • Develop and update application documentation for hand-off to Salesforce Support team
